Grid Dynamics vs Kanerika: overview

Grid Dynamics

Grid Dynamics was founded in 2006 by Victoria Livschitz and is a publicly traded company (Nasdaq: GDYN) headquartered in the San Ramon/Fremont area of California, with over 4,500 employees globally. The company partnered with Temporal Technologies to launch an agentic AI platform aimed at enterprise-scale deployments.

Kanerika

Kanerika was founded in 2015 and is headquartered in Austin, Texas, with primary development centers in Hyderabad, India, and roughly 200-500 employees. The company builds named production agents (including internally branded agents for data insights, document intelligence, and customer service) and is recognized by Everest Group as a top Data & AI specialist.
